Document Description
The San Joaquin River Multi-Benefit Project consists of rehabilitating the existing levee between Stations 330+00 and 368+00 on Sherman Island to meet the Delta-Specific PL 84-99 Standard. Prior to construction of the levee improvements, existing power poles and associated overhead utility lines within the project area will be relocated outside the project area. The project includes removing the existing Sacramento County road, placing compacted embankment to raise the levee crown and achieve the required freeboard above the 100-year flood elevation, constructing a landside levee toe berm to stabilize the levee slope, constructing a new County road, and establishing approximately 1 acre of hedgerow habitat consisting of riparian forest and scrub-shrub vegetation on the landside toe berm. Plantings will be monitored and maintained to ensure success criteria are met.
